Marvel Vs Capcom 3 Pc
Feb. 17, 2025
Save 70% on ULTIMATE MARVEL VS. CAPCOM 3 on Steam ULTIMATE MARVEL VS. CAPCOM 3 | PC | CDKeys Ultimate Marvel vs. Capcom 3 - Wikipedia Ultimate Marvel vs. Capcom 3 coming to PC, Xbox One March 7 - Polygon | Marvel Vs Capcom 3 Pc